Tex-Mex$$uptownMon-Sat 11am-9:30pm, Sun 11am-9pm
Operating since 1981, Mia's serves the brisket tacos that became a Dallas archetype. The original family recipes and the loyal crowd of regulars make this an institution on Lemmon Avenue.
Order: Brisket tacos, the dish that earned Mia's citywide loyalty. Cheese enchiladas with chili con carne.
Tip: The brisket taco was created by founder Butch Enriquez. The original recipe still runs the kitchen.
Tex-Mex$uptownMon-Thu 11am-9pm, Fri-Sat 11am-10pm, Sun 11am-9pm
Founded 1918 by Mike Martinez, El Fenix is the oldest Tex-Mex chain in the US, credited with formalising the enchilada-chili-gravy combination plate Dallas loves.
Order: Cheese enchiladas with chili gravy. The combination plate that opened in 1918.
Tip: The McKinney Ave location is the flagship. The weekday lunch combo runs under $12 and changes daily.
